Output 6acd5739a89e61708586cf3445215a10f67486842f514b76f07f452076b1416c:0

value
7890530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ece3d599b344a221d3a166531eccb6c10286c680 OP_EQUAL
address
3PHaL2Sq8b8YUSAAHVQvk95veXXqcVfbrd
transaction
6acd5739a89e61708586cf3445215a10f67486842f514b76f07f452076b1416c
confirmations
291490
spent
true